A knuckle duster, also known as brass knuckles, is a handheld weapon designed to enhance the impact of a punch. Here are some key features:
Key Features:
- Design: Typically consists of a metal piece with finger holes that fit around the knuckles. This design concentrates the force of a punch onto a smaller area, increasing the potential for damage
- Materials: Often made from brass, steel, aluminum, or other durable metals. Some modern versions may also use high-strength plastics or carbon fiber
- Usage: Primarily used in hand-to-hand combat to deliver more powerful blows. Historically, they have been used for self-defense and in military applications
- Variations: Some knuckle dusters include additional features such as spikes or blades, enhancing their effectiveness in combat

Knuckle dusters have a long history, dating back to ancient civilizations where similar weapons were used in combat. They remain controversial due to their ease of concealment and potential for misuse
